The compositions of composer and sound artist Paul Hauptmeier unfold through multichannel sound, live electronics, augmented reality and large-scale installations, turning the listener’s movement and position into part of the experience. Much of Hauptmeier’s work begins with listening as a physical act: sounds are captured from places, transformed through synthesis and then scattered through speaker systems to acquire their own trajectories through a room. Alongside Martin Recker, he forms the duo Hauptmeier | Recker, whose work stretches from electroacoustic composition and radiophonic pieces to opera, multimedia performance and site-specific installations. Their custom software LEMM allows sound to be manipulated and spatialised in real time, while projects such as Diaphanous Sound have extended these ideas into augmented reality. As a founding member of Leipzig’s ZiMMT, Hauptmeier has also helped develop a broader culture around spatial listening.
